Web11 mei 2024 · Australopithecus afarensis. 'Lucy' dates to 3.2 MYA. She was discovered in 1974 in Hadar, Ethiopia. She is generally believed to be the oldest discovered ancestor to modern Homo sapiens. 'Lucy' stood at only 3 ½ feet tall even though she was a mature Australopithecus afarensis.
